EMCORE Corporation and Sandia National Laboratories Sign Agreement for the Development of Concentrator Photovoltaic Power Systems


SOMERSET, N.J., July 28 // -- EMCORE Corporation (NASDAQ:EMKR), a leading provider of compound semiconductor-based components and subsystems for the broadband, fiber optic, satellite, solar power and wireless communications markets, today announced that it has signed a contract with Sandia National Laboratories. Sandia will provide technical support for EMCORE's terrestrial solar systems products. Sandia has worked for over 25 years in the development of photovoltaics for grid-tied, utility scale power generation.

EMCORE's CEO, Reuben Richards, said, "EMCORE is the leading supplier of GaAs, multi-junction solar cell technology for power generation on satellites. EMCORE is adapting its state-of-the-art solar cell technology as a base for the development of large scale, concentrator photovoltaic power systems. Our goal is to become the leader in solar energy power systems. We have a very successful track record in commercializing next generation technologies, as we have done in the satellite market. Sandia has long been a valuable partner in technology development for EMCORE. We look forward to their contributions to our program in terrestrial power systems."

Dr Jeff Nelson. Manager of the Sandia Solar Technologies Group, stated, "We are happy to work with EMCORE on these programs. Sandia has worked for many years on the development of solar power. EMCORE, with its advanced solar cell technology, provides an excellent path for the commercialization of this technology."

About EMCORE

EMCORE Corporation offers a broad portfolio of compound semiconductor-based products for the broadband, fiber optic, satellite, solar power and wireless communications markets. EMCORE's Fiber Optic segment offers optical components, subsystems and systems for high speed data and telecommunications networks, cable television (CATV) and fiber-to-the-premises (FTTP). EMCORE's Photovoltaic segment provides products for both satellite and terrestrial applications. For satellite applications, EMCORE offers high efficiency Gallium Arsenide (GaAs) solar cells, Covered Interconnect Cells (CICs) and panels. For terrestrial applications, EMCORE is adapting its high-efficiency GaAs solar cells for use in solar concentrator systems. Our Electronic Materials and Devices segment provides radio frequency (RF) transistor materials for high bandwidth wireless communications systems. Through its joint venture participation in GELcore, LLC, EMCORE plays a significant role in developing and commercializing next-generation High-Brightness LED technology for use in the general and specialty illumination markets.
